Investigation of concrete piles under varying conditions in sea-water
To examine variations in durability of different types of concrete with regard to seawater and frost, concrete piles were stored in tidal zone for past 27 yr; test specimens were exposed to conditions similar to those found in fairly hard coast climate by Norwegian standards; 42 reinforced pillars 20×20×230 cm were made, 38 were cast in laboratory and given special curing, while other four were concreted in field; nine types of cement with various mineral contents were examined and tests also included aggregates of two different gradings; correlation between diminishing content of C3A in cements and respective durability of concrete is shown.
